1, promote childhood obesity
Particularly fond of a drink of children, often on the physical development of the polarization: either chubby pier, or is very thin. Sugary carbonated drinks in about 10%, a 355 ml volume of sugary carbonated drinks is about 40 grams daily intake of two cans of carbonated beverages, there is 320 kcal of energy. More than three consecutive months on the intake of 28,800 kcal of energy, representing an increase of 4.1 kg of fat.
2, impact of child appetite
Drink carbonated drinks is another problem affecting appetite and digestion, so that the child's growth and increased risk of malnutrition. Release of carbon dioxide carbonated drinks can easily lead to bloating, affecting appetite, especially when sweating a lot to drink iced soft drinks, cold to the expansion of capillaries and rapid closure, to stimulate the gastrointestinal tract, resulting in digestive disorders, nausea , vomiting, abdominal pain, bloating, diarrhea and other symptoms.
3, easily lead to tooth decay
Dental caries is caused by sugary drinks the most important dietary factor. Carbonated drinks containing carbonic acid, phosphoric acid, highly acidic, with sugar fermentation in the mouth of acidic products, the teeth have a strong corrosive effect of the stimulus, which will soften the enamel on the tooth cavity formation play a catalytic role. Deciduous and permanent teeth of children less calcification, enamel and cementum is relatively thin, as there is no adult teeth good degree of calcification, compared with the more vulnerable to dental caries.
4, loss of calcium
Often a large number of young people drinking carbonated beverages serious loss of calcium, the risk of fracture is three times that of other young people. Intense physical activity at the same time, then excessive drinking carbonated beverages may increase the risk of fracture times. Soft drinks and more children often do not like drinking milk, eating habits unreasonable, and therefore can not intake enough calcium, which is caused by calcium deficiency is the direct cause; In addition, most carbonated drinks contain phosphoric acid, phosphoric acid intake on will affect the absorption of calcium, causing calcium and phosphorus imbalance, affecting bone deposition, resulting in slow bone development, reduce the amount of peak bone, and even osteoporosis.
